Дерево двудольный граф – это граф, особая структура, которая состоит из двух долей, между которыми нет ребер. Такой граф является основой многих математических моделей, которые применяются в различных областях науки и техники. В этой статье мы рассмотрим основные свойства и примеры деревьев двудольных графов, а также докажем, что любой граф является деревом двудольным графом, если и только если в нем нет нечётных циклов.
Доказательство этого факта основывается на свойствах двудольных графов и широко применяется в теории графов. Важно отметить, что каждый граф можно представить в виде дерева двудольного графа, раскрасив его вершины в два цвета – один для каждой доли. Это позволяет эффективно решать различные задачи, связанные с графами, например, поиск максимального паросочетания или определение гамильтонова цикла.
Примеры деревьев двудольных графов можно найти в различных областях – от биологии до экономики. Например, в биологических сетях деревья двудольные графы применяются для моделирования взаимодействий между организмами или генами. В экономике они могут использоваться для анализа взаимодействий между различными субъектами или компаниями.
Таким образом, дерево двудольный граф является мощным инструментом, который может быть использован для моделирования различных ситуаций и решения разнообразных задач. Понимание его свойств и применение в практике открывает широкие возможности для изучения и анализа графов.
Дерево двудольный граф
В дереве двудольного графа нет циклов, то есть не существует пути, который вернется в исходную вершину. Это свойство делает дерево двудольный граф особенно полезным для моделирования различных практических задач.
Дерево двудольного графа имеет несколько свойств:
- Количество вершин в первой доле равно количеству вершин во второй доле.
- Максимальное количество ребер, которое может быть в дереве двудольного графа, равно произведению количества вершин в каждой доле.
- Если в дереве двудольного графа удалить одну вершину и все ребра, связанные с ней, граф остается связным.
Примерами практического применения дерева двудольного графа являются задачи о распределении ресурсов, планировании задач и моделировании подобных ситуаций.
Дерево двудольного граф является одной из важных структур данных в графовой теории и имеет много различных приложений в реальном мире.
Доказательство существования дерева двудольного графа
У любого связного графа существует деление его вершин на две доли таким образом, что каждое ребро графа соединяет вершины различных долей.
Доказательство этого утверждения может быть проведено с помощью алгоритма обхода графа в ширину. Алгоритм начинает с выбора произвольной вершины и помещает ее в первую долю. Затем алгоритм обходит все непосещенные вершины графа, добавляя их во вторую долю. При этом алгоритм обрабатывает все ребра графа, и если обнаруживает ребро, соединяющее две вершины из одной доли, то граф не является двудольным и алгоритм прекращает свою работу.
Если алгоритм успешно завершается, то граф оказывается двудольным, и разделение вершин на доли, полученное в процессе обхода, даёт нам дерево двудольного графа.
Примером применения данного доказательства является следующая ситуация: представим, что у нас есть компания, в которой сотрудники занимаются двумя направлениями – разработкой программного обеспечения и тестированием. У нас есть информация о связях между сотрудниками, и нам нужно определить, могут ли эти два направления работать автономно, независимо друг от друга. Мы можем представить сотрудников компании в виде вершин графа и связи между ними в виде ребер. Если мы можем разделить сотрудников на две группы таким образом, чтобы в каждой группе были сотрудники только одного направления, то это означает, что компания может работать двудольно — каждое направление может работать независимо от другого.
Свойства дерева двудольного графа
Дерево двудольного графа имеет несколько важных свойств:
1. | Каждое ребро графа соединяет вершины, принадлежащие разным долям. |
2. | Граф не содержит циклов. |
3. | Количество вершин в каждой доле равно. |
4. | Максимальное количество ребер в дереве двудольного графа равно произведению количеств вершин в каждой доле. |
5. | Минимальное количество ребер в дереве двудольного графа равно максимальному потоку. |
Эти свойства позволяют использовать деревья двудольных графов в различных задачах. Они могут быть полезны при моделировании социальных сетей, планировании расписаний, оптимизации процессов и других задачах.
Примеры двудольных графов
Двудольные графы встречаются во многих областях, и они помогают нам изучать различные свойства и характеристики объектов.
Ниже приведены несколько примеров двудольных графов:
Граф | Описание |
---|---|
A -- B A -- B | | или | | C -- D E -- F | В первом примере граф состоит из двух долей, помеченных A и B, и соединенных ребрами. Вершины A и B соединены ребром, а также вершины C и D. Граф второго примера также содержит две доли, но ребра соединяют вершины разных долей. |
A -- B -- C | | D -- E -- F | В этом примере граф также состоит из двух долей, но вершины в каждой доле соединены ребрами только с вершинами из другой доли. Например, вершина A соединена только с B, а вершина B соединена с A и C. |
Это лишь некоторые примеры двудольных графов. В реальном мире их можно встретить в различных задачах, таких как распределение ресурсов, планирование расписания и оптимизация процессов.